Comprehending the IELTS Test
Before delving into the principle of a guaranteed IELTS certificate, it's vital to comprehend what the IELTS test involves. The IELTS is designed to assess a prospect's efficiency in 4 essential areas of language: Listening, Reading, Writing, and Speaking. The test comes in 2 formats: Academic and General Training. The Academic format is typically needed for greater education and professional registration, while the General Training format is used for work experience, training programs, and migration purposes.

Secret Components of the IELTS Test
- Listening (30 minutes): Candidates listen to 4 recorded texts and answer 40 questions.
- Reading (60 minutes): The Academic test consists of three long texts, while the General Training test features texts from books, publications, and newspapers.
- Composing (60 minutes): The Academic test requires 2 composing tasks, a 150-word report and a 250-word essay. The General Training test includes a letter and an essay.
- Speaking (11-14 minutes): A face-to-face interview with an examiner, consisting of 3 parts: an introduction and interview, a long turn, and a discussion.
The Myth of the Guaranteed IELTS Certificate
The promise of a "guaranteed IELTS certificate" is a common marketing strategy utilized by some organizations and people. However, it is crucial to acknowledge that such an assurance is not only misleading but also impossible to satisfy. The IELTS is a standardized, globally acknowledged test, and the outcomes are determined by the efficiency of the candidate on the day of the test. No external party can affect the scoring process or ensure a specific band score.
Why a Guaranteed Certificate Is Unreliable
- Test Integrity: The IELTS test is administered and scored by the British Council, IDP: IELTS Australia, and Cambridge Assessment English. These organizations keep rigorous requirements of test stability and security.
- Variable Performance: Each test-taker's performance can differ due to aspects such as test anxiety, health, and preparation.
- Ethical Concerns: Offering a guaranteed certificate is dishonest and may involve deceptive activities, such as test leakages or score manipulation, which are illegal and can result in extreme consequences.

FAQs About the IELTS Test
1. What is the IELTS test, and how is it scored?
The IELTS test evaluates a prospect's proficiency in Listening, Reading, Writing, and Speaking. Each area is scored on a scale of 0 to 9, and the overall band score is the average of the four section scores.
2. The length of time does it require to get ready for the IELTS?
Preparation time differs depending upon the person's present English level and target score. Typically, it is recommended to study for at least 6-12 weeks, dedicating a number of hours each week to practice and study.
3. Can I retake the IELTS if I don't attain my preferred score?
Yes, you can retake the IELTS as lot of times as needed, but there is a 90-day waiting period in between test attempts. Each retake requires a new registration and payment.
4. What is the distinction in between the Academic and General Training IELTS?
The Academic IELTS is created for candidates using to greater education or professional registration, while the General Training IELTS is ideal for those seeking work experience, training programs, or migration.
5. How can I enhance my speaking skills for the IELTS?
To enhance your speaking skills, practice speaking in English as much as possible, record yourself to determine locations for enhancement, and seek feedback from native speakers or tutors.
6. Is the IELTS test simple to cheat on?
No, the IELTS test has strict security steps to avoid cheating. Test centers use biometric verification, secure test products, and rigorous monitoring to guarantee the integrity of the test.
